1947 Print Marchand's Hair Wash Color Blond Poster Ad ORIGINAL HISTORIC POS1 LHJ6 The World's Columbian Exposition was"Won't let time darken your hair" This is an original 1947 halftone print of an advertising poster for Marchand's Golden Hair Wash. Artist: Michael. Agency: The Joseph Katz Company. Period Paper is pleased to offer a fascinating collection of prints (both color and black and white) of the finest examples of poster advertising art of 1946 as judged by J. I. Biegeleisen.
